  • HT4528 How do you download pics from iPhone to laptop w/o a usb cord?

    how do you download pics to laptop?

    If you have an iCloud account with Photo Stream enabled with the account settings on your iPhone and with Photo Stream enabled with your iCloud account settings on your computer, all photos captured by your iPhone or saved by the iPhone which are saved in the iPhone's Camera Roll, will be available in your Photo Stream automatically if the iPhone is connected to an available wi-fi network at the time, or will be uploaded to your Photo Stream when the iPhone becomes connected to an available wi-fi network. This will make the photos available in your Photo Stream on your computer without having to import the photos from your iPhone's Camera Roll which requires a USB connection.
    You can transfer the photos in the Photo Stream on your computer to be saved locally on your computer's hard drive.

  • Importing contacts from iPhone to MacBook Pro's address book

    Do I need to download and install iTunes onto my MacBook Pro, in order to transfer contacts from my iPhone into my MacBook Pro's address book? If I simply plug my iPhone into my MacBook Pro's USB port, is there a way to get it to sync to my address book? Or do I need to first install iTunes; as is the case for syncing to Outlook running under Windows?

    You need iTunes (it should already be on your MBP, though!).
    Also, if your goal is to transfer the contacts from the iPhone to the computer, you must have at least one new contact in the MBP's Address Book app. If it's empty, the contacts on the phone will be wiped. Create a new (dummy) contact, then sync the iPhone and you'll be prompted to Merge or Replace the data - choose the Merge option.

  • How do you export contacts from iphone 3g to car

    I have a 2009 MB C300 sport.  I paired the phone with no problem.  I can't export contacts to the car.  Nor can I manually enter the contacts using the buttons on the car's panel. 

    iPhone only supports PBAP(phone book access profile). If your vehicle's bluetooth system does not support PBAP as well, there is no way to make your contacts available.
